Here's a look at the players who are best in the metrics, based on the data collected so far. We're listing players with a minimum of 30 passes. First, the top 10 in Stop Rate. (Stop Rate measures percentage of plays that do not achieve offensive success by Football Outsiders standards: 45% of yards on first down, 60% on second down, 100% on third down.)
* 32-A.Jones TEN 52 65%
* 28-L.Bodden CLE 31 65%
* 31-R.Marshall CAR 35 63%
* 33-C.Tillman CHI 75 63%
* 21-C.McAlister BAL 53 62%
* 20-C.Gamble CAR 38 61%
* 29-D.Florence SD 55 60%
* 26-L.Sheppard PHI 35 60%
* 22-F.Thomas NO 49 59%
* 36-D.Barrett NYJ 34 59%
